Pre

I dagens ljudlandskap är ljudprocessorn central för hur vi fångar, formar och återger ljud. Oavsett om du bygger hemmastudio, producerar musik, arbetar med live-ljud eller forskar inom akustik och röstteknik så spelar en Ljudprocessor en avgörande roll. Denna artikel guidar dig genom vad en ljudprocessor är, hur den fungerar, vilka typer som finns, och hur du väljer rätt lösning för dina behov. Vi går igenom tekniska begrepp, algoritmer och praktiska tips som hjälper dig att få maximal prestanda och ljudkvalitet.

Vad är en Ljudprocessor och varför är den viktig?

En Ljudprocessor är en enhet eller mjukvarukomponent som kör digital signalbehandling på ljudsignaler i realtid. Den tar inkommande digitala ljudvärden, applicerar olika matematiska operationer och levererar bearbetat ljud ut till högtalare, hörlurar eller vidare spår. I praktiken används Ljudprocessorer för att göra allt från equalization och kompression till rumskorrigering, röstförstärkning och avancerade effekter. Genom att flytta bearbetningen till en dedikerad enhet eller ett högpresterande mjukvarupaket kan man uppnå mycket lägre latens, bättre kontroll över filtrering och konsekvent ljudkvalitet över olika system.

När vi talar om Ljudprocessor i olika sammanhang kan begreppet referera till olika arkitekturer: en DSP-baserad enhet, en CPU-/GPU-baserad mjukvaruplattform, eller ett FPGA-fordon som kör specialiserade algoritmer. Oavsett lösningens typ är målet att realisera högkvalitativa ljudbearbetningsfunktioner med låga fördröjningar och stabilt beteende under olika arbetsbelastningar.

De grundläggande funktionerna i en Ljudprocessor varierar beroende på krav och användningsområde. Men vanligt förekommande moduler inkluderar:

  • Filter och equalization (EQ) för exakt frekvensrespons.
  • Kompression och expansion som kontrollerar dynamiken.
  • De-essing och brusminimering för röstklarhet.
  • Rumskorrigering och akustikmodellering för att motverka problem i olika lyssningsrum.
  • Spatial ljud och volymskontroll för bevisskapande av ljudbild.
  • Effekter som reverb, delay och modulation.

En viktig aspekt är latens, dvs. hur lång tid det tar från att ljudsignalen fångas till att bearbetad signal levereras. För musikproduktion och live-ljud är låg latens kritisk, särskilt när monitorering kräver exakt synkronisering med musikerna. En välkonfigurerad Ljudprocessor balanserar komplexa algoritmer med minimalt fördröjning och stabilt arbetsflöde.

Det finns flera arkitekturer som används för att implementera en ljudprocessor. Här går vi igenom de mest vanliga:

Digital signalprocessorer (DSP) är specialiserade processorer optimerade för realtids DSP-uppgifter. De erbjuder ofta mycket låga latens och hög effektivitet när det gäller energianvändning och kylning. Fördelarna med DSP-sbaserade Ljudprocessor är tydliga: konsekvent prestanda, realtidspaneler och förutsägbara tidskrav. De används ofta i professionella ljudlösningar, studioutrustning och kommersiella ljudsystem där pålitlighet och låga fördröjningar är viktigast.

Begränsningar kan inkludera kostnad, hårdvarustrukturens begränsningar och svårigheter att uppgradera algoritmer efter lansering. DSP-kärnor kräver ofta optimering av kod och specifika instruksspråk för att utnyttja arkitekturens potential fullt ut.

CPU-/mjukvarubaserade ljudprocessorer

Här körs Ljudprocessor-algoritmerna i en allmän CPU eller i grafikkortets kärnor (GPU) med hjälp av mjukvara i ett operativsystem. Denna lösning ger extrem flexibilitet: enkelt att uppdatera, testa nya algoritmer och integrera med befintliga arbetsflöden i studion. Plug-ins, DAW-instrument och mjukvarubaserade effekter är exempel på vad som ofta används i denna kategori. Den största styrkan är anpassningsbarhet och kostnadseffektivitet, särskilt för små studios och projektbaserade användare.

Nackdelarna är att realtidsprestandan kan vara beroende av systemets CPU-belastning och operativsystemets scheduler. Latens kan öka om flera tunga plug-ins körs samtidigt, vilket kräver noggrann CPU-allokering och ibland specialoptimeringar i mjukvaran.

FPGA-baserade ljudprocessorer

FPGAs (fältprogrammable gate array) erbjuder en tredje väg där algoritmer implementeras direkt i logik som kan konfigureras för extremt låga latens och mycket hög genomströmning. FPGA-baserade ljudprocessorer används ofta i mycket krävande miljöer som broadcast-ljud, live-ljud med stora konsekvenser eller forskningsprojekt där anpassade algoritmer kräver speciallösningar. Fördelarna inkluderar parallellbearbetning och potentialen att köra flera olika algoritmer samtidigt med mycket låg fördröjning. Nackdelar är att utvecklingen ofta kräver mer specialkunskap och längre tid till marknad.

Hur fungerar en Ljudprocessor i praktiken?

Praktisk förståelse för hur en Ljudprocessor fungerar hjälper dig att välja rätt plattform och optimera dina projekt. Nyckelbegreppen inkluderar latens, genomströmning (throughput), bufferthantering och algoritmisk effektivitet.

Latens och genomströmning

Latens beskriver tidsfördröjningen från att ljudsignalen går in tills bearbetad signal levereras. Den mått som ofta används är millisekunder (ms). För musikproduktion vill man ofta hålla total latens under 5–10 ms i studiomiljöer, medan live-ljudsystem kräver ännu lägre latens för att undvika monitorerings-efterreaktioner och desynkronisering. Genomströmning handlar om hur mycket ljuddata som kan bearbetas per tidsenhet utan att köra upp systemet i väntetillstånd. Vid högupplöst sampling och komplexa effekter kan krävd genomströmning bli betydande, särskilt i mjukvarubaserade lösningar.

ADC/DAC-latens och buffertar

Analog-till-digital-omvandlar (ADC) och digital-till-analog-omvandlar (DAC) bidrar vardera till totala latensen. Även buffertstorlek i ljudgränssnittens drivrutiner spelar stor roll. Mindre buffertar ger lägre latency men kräver mer stabil och kraftfull bearbetning. Många Ljudprocessor-designers väljer att utföra kritiska delar av bearbetningen i fast-latens domäner, medan mindre kritiska delar kan köras i längre buffertar för ökad stabilitet.

Programdesign och arbetsflöde

Inom en Ljudprocessor är det vanligt att designa modulära arbetsflöden där olika block hanterar specifika uppgifter: EQ, kompression, spatialisering, och effekter. Effektiva designmönster ser till att data passerar från ett block till nästa med minimal kopiering, pekarfel och minnesåtkomst. Realistiskt krävs en balans mellan lägsta möjliga latens och en robust arkitektur som hanterar allvarliga toppar i arbetsbelastning utan att förlora ljudkvalitet eller stabilitet.

De algoritmer och funktioner som du hittar i moderna Ljudprocessor-system delas ofta upp i flera grupper. Vi beskriver här de mest använda och hur de påverkar ljudkvaliteten.

Kompression reglerar dynamik och hjälper att hålla signalnivåer inom ett önskat område. Moderne Ljudprocessor erbjuder ofta flera former av kompression: kontrollerad förspänningskompression, multiband-kompression och viskös optisk kompression beroende på tillverkare. Equalization ajusterar frekvensresponsen och kan vara grafisk, parametisk eller vardera i flera band. Filtrering används för att ta bort oönskat brus eller störningar samt för att forma ljudet i rumsliga sammanhang. En välbalanserad kombination av EQ och kompressor skapar en jämn, rytmiskt engagerande ljudbild utan att förlust av naturlighet.

När det kommer till röst- och vokalproduktion är brusreducering och de-essing kritiskt. Brusreducering minimerar bakgrundsljud och störningar utan att förvränga röstens Klarhet. De-essing tar bort eller mjukar upp s-ljud som annars kan bli skarpa och obekväma. Dessa funktioner är särskilt viktiga i live-ljudmiljöer och i podcast-/talproduktion där tydlighet och tonkontroll avgör publikens upplevelse.

Rumskorrigering korrigerar effekter som orsakas av lyssningsrumets akustik. Tekniker använder mätningar av rummet och algoritmer som anpassar signalen till mottagarens position. Spatial ljud, 3D-ljud och binaural rendering ger lyssnaren en upplevelse av rum och placering, oavsett vilken utgångsplattform som används. Ambisonics och HRTF-baserad rendering är vanligt förekommande i ljudprocessorer som syftar till en rik, realistisk ljudbild.

Beroende på sammanhang och krav kan en ljudprocessor vara specialiserad för olika miljöer och uppgifter. Nedan presenteras några vanliga scenarier och hur Ljudprocessor-teknik anpassas för varje fall.

För hembaserade studios är kostnadseffektivitet, enkel installation och användarvänlighet centrala krav. Många mjukvarubaserade ljudprocessorer erbjuder omfattande GUI, färdiga presets och plugin-liknande arbetsflöden som passar nybörjare och hobbyister. En Ljudprocessor i hemmiljö behöver vanligtvis ligga i mitten av spektrumet vad gäller prestanda och funktioner, och man kan ofta uppgradera med en hårdvarukälla för att få bättre latency och stabilitet. Viktiga överväganden inkluderar kompatibilitet med din DAW, stöd för olika ljudkort och möjligheten att låta mjukvaran köra i realtid utan avbrott.

Professionella ljudmiljöer kräver ofta robusta system med låga latens och förutsägbara prestanda under press. Här används ofta kombinationer av DSP-kort med hårdvarusanpassade effekter, eller FPGA-baserade lösningar för extremt low-latency-processer. Live-ljud kräver att Ljudprocessor kan hantera plötsliga toppar, olika digitala ljudgränssnitt, och att systemet fungerar under varierande temperaturer och miljöer. Dessa applikationer drar nytta av dedikerad hårdvara, redundans, och tydliga arbetsflöden för snabb felsökning.

Inom forskning och utveckling används ofta anpassade ljudprocessorer och prototyper för att utföra experiment, testa nya algoritmer och undersöka mänsklig perception. FPGA- eller ASIC-lösningar används ibland när man behöver enorm parallell bearbetning eller mycket hög precision. I industriella sammanhang, som telekommunikation och medicinsk ljudbearbetning, krävs särskilda regler och certifieringar som påverkar val av plattform och arkitektur.

När du väljer Ljudprocessor krävs en jämförelse av nyckelspecifikationer. Här är de centrala parametrarna som ofta avgör vilket system som passar bäst.

Sampling rate, till exempel 44,1 kHz, 96 kHz eller ännu högre, bestämmer hur exakt ljudet fångas och återges. Högre sampling ger bättre frekvensupplösning men kräver mer processorkraft. Bitdjupet påverkar dynamikområdet och ljudkvaliteten. En Ljudprocessor som hanterar högupplösta ljud kräver effektivt utnyttjande av minne och snabb databehandling för att bevara detaljer i ljudet utan att skapa fördröjningar.

Som nämnts tidigare varierar latenskrav mellan applikationer. Låg latens kräver oftast att algoritmerna körs i kritiska vägar utan onödiga kopieringar eller minnesåtkomst som kan skapa flaskhalsar. Genomströmning och CPU-kärnornas antal är avvägningar: fler kärnor och specialiserade instruktionsuppsättningar kan öka genomströmningen men kräver mer komplicerad design och testning.

Inom Ljudprocessor-industrin används ofta kraftfulla DSP-kärnor som stödjer SIMD (Single Instruction, Multiple Data) för att bearbeta flera ljudkanaler parallellt. SIMD-sinstruktioner gör att samma operation kan utföras på flera samples samtidigt, vilket ökar prestanda avsevärt vid uppgifter som filtrering och kanaliserad EQ. Val av plattform innebär att man bedömer vilka uppsättningar som stöds, hur lätt det är att optimera koden och vilken typ av utvecklingsmiljö som finns tillgänglig.

Ljudelektronik utvecklas i snabb takt. Här är några av de mest intressanta trenderna som formar framtidens Ljudprocessor-teknik.

Artificiell intelligens och maskininlärning öppnar nya möjligheter inom röstformatering, brusreducering, rumsmodellering och ljudigenkänning. Genom att träna modeller på stora ljuddataset kan en ljudprocessor lära sig att känna igen och anpassa sig till olika ljudmiljöer, användning och preferenser. AI-drivna funktioner kan erbjuda mer sofistikerad röstförstärkning, automatisk equalization som anpassar sig till registrerade instrument eller sångröster och dynamiska effekter som reagerar på musikens känsla.

På senare tid har vi sett en tydlig splittring mellan edge processing (bearbetning direkt på enheten) och cloud-baserad ljudbehandling. Edge-lösningar ger låg latens, ökad integritet och stabilitet i miljöer där uppkoppling kan vara opålitlig. Molnbaserad behandling erbjuder i sin tur kraftfulla maskinläromodeller och större beräkningskapacitet utan att belasta användarens lokala maskinvara. Framöver ser vi sannolikt en hybridmodell där vissa kritiska uppgifter körs lokalt och mer resurskrävande uppgifter körs i molnet eller i lokala edge-enheter.

Att välja rätt Ljudprocessor handlar om att matcha krav med arkitektur, kostnad, och användarupplevelse. Här är en praktisk checklista att använda när du gör ditt val.

Identifiera vilka funktioner som är mest kritiska: låg latens för monitorering, hög dynamik för viss musikgenre, eller avancerad rumsmodellering för inspelning i olika miljöer. Om du arbetar mycket med live-ljud kan en FPGA- eller DSP-baserad lösning vara lämplig, medan hemmastudion kan dra nytta av mjukvarubaserade Ljudprocessor-lösningar med flexibilitet i upplägg och pris.

Fundera över hur enkelt det är att uppgradera, lägga till nya funktioner eller byta algoritmer. Mjukvarubaserade Ljudprocessor-plattformar erbjuder ofta snabbare uppdateringar och enklare integration med befintliga arbetsflöden, medan hårdvarubaserade system kan ge stabilare prestanda men kräva större investeringar vid förändringar.

Säkerställ att Ljudprocessor-lösningen fungerar väl med din nuvarande DAW, ljudkort, mikrofoner och övrig utrustning. Det är också bra att kontrollera vilka plug-ins och algoritmer som redan stöds och hur enkel integrationen är med externa enheter som fältmindre processorer och mixers.

Det kan vara frestande att välja en billig lösning, men överväg livscykelkostnader: licenser, underhåll, uppdateringar och energianvändning. I professionella applikationer kan total ägandekostnad bli en av de viktigaste faktorerna, särskilt när systemet används dagligen över flera år.

Oavsett vilken typ av Ljudprocessor du väljer finns det praktiska sätt att optimera prestanda och ljudkvalitet.

Planera ljudkedjan i tydliga steg: ingångsfiltrering och konvertering, dynamisk bearbetning, spatialisering och slutlig output. Minimera antalet onödiga buffertbyten och kopiering av ljuddata. Använd fast-routing där det är möjligt och undvik onödiga omläggningar mellan olika minnesområden.

Färgade ljudprofiler, baserade på genre eller användningsområde, kan spara tid och ge konsekventa resultat. För hörlursmonitorering eller live-målförhållanden kan du skapa presets som snabbt anpassar EQ, kompression och brusreducering efter rum eller justerat uppspelningsutrustning.

Utför noggranna tester med olika ljudkällor, volymnivåer och rumsmiljöer. Använd hörlurar, studiomonitorer och referensmusik för att validera ljudbilden. Kolla efter artefakter vid olika latensnivåer och se till att systemet reagerar stabilt under olika arbetsbelastningar. Felaktiga eller ojämna effekter kan starkt påverka upplevelsen och arbetsflödet.

Planera regelbundna uppdateringar av mjukvara och firmware. Säkerhetskopiera konfigurationer och projektfiler före uppdateringar. Håll koll på supportnivåer och livscykler för de enheter som används i systemet.

Här följer svar på några vanliga frågor som ofta dyker upp när man undersöker Ljudprocessor-teknik:

En ljudprocessor är fokus på att bearbeta signalen med olika algoritmer. Ett ljudkort (gränssnitt) hanterar konvertering mellan analoga och digitala signaler samt ofta viss förbehandling i realtid. Många moderna lösningar kombinerar båda funktionerna i en enhet där ljudprocessorn kör sina algoritmer direkt på kortet eller i mjukvaran som kommunicerar med kortet.

Ja, i många fall. Mjukvarubaserade Ljudprocessor-plattformar används ofta i vanliga datorer med tillräcklig CPU-kraft och minimal belastning. Det är viktigt att optimera drivrutiner, ha låga systemlatensinställningar och använda effektiva algoritmer för att uppnå realtidsresultat utan hissningar eller fördröjningar.

De viktigaste måtten är latens, genomströmning, ljudkvalitet och stabilitet under hög belastning. Andra viktiga faktorer inkluderar kompatibilitet, energi- och kylbehov samt möjlighet till framtida uppgraderingar.

En Ljudprocessor är en av hörnstenarna i modern ljudproduktion och ljudåtergivning. Oavsett om du väljer en DSP-baserad enhet, en mjukvarubaserad lösning eller en FPGA-arkitektur kommer du att mötas av ett växande ekosystem av algoritmer och verktyg som gör det möjligt att forma ljud på nya och helt unika sätt. Genom att förstå de centrala principerna – latens, genomströmning, arkitektur och algoritmer – kan du skräddarsy din ljudprocess till dina specifika behov och uppnå professionell ljudkvalitet som känns naturlig, exakt och engagerande. Ljudprocessor-teknik fortsätter att utvecklas med AI-drivna processer, edge-lösningar och smart integration i befintliga arbetsflöden. Genom att hålla fokus på vad som verkligen räknas för din produktion eller ditt projekt kan du maximera både ljudkvalitet och effektivitet i varje steg av processen.

En Ljudprocessor är mer än bara en enhet som filtrerar ljud; det är en helt ekosystem som kombinerar teknik, kreativ kontroll och praktisk användarvänlighet. Genom att välja rätt typ av Ljudprocessor – oavsett DSP, CPU eller FPGA – och genom att optimera din ljudkedja, dina algoritmer och dina arbetsflöden kan du uppnå tydligt bättre ljudkvalitet, lägre latens och en mer flexibel produktion. Oavsett om du utvecklar nästa stora ljudteknik eller bara vill få ditt hemmastudio att låta som proffs, står Ljudprocessor som en nyckelkomponent i din ljuddesignresa.